    Afterthought. The Southern Africa pilot career is much alike to North America where you have to build hours instructing and contract jobs until you are eligible for right seat of an airliner. But of course the diversity in your career can lead you to specialising as a charter bush pilot, contract pilot i.e. in DRC working UN jobs, medivac etc vs Europe and some Asian countries where you get a direct entry programme into the airline from flight school for those who want an airline career

      Yes, but conditional to, If you are a Botswana citizen, when you’ll finish your training. Remember operators are still recovering from the pandemic, and as far as I am aware demand is far from pre pandemic levels so recruitment is likely low. This is likely to change as months and immediate years come by. A number of Batswana pilots were made redundant during the peak of pandemic period so account for that. Best advice, make direct contact with these operators - face to face to estimate what’s the best path for you.

      I would say around the years of 2012 there were a lot of Europeans/North Americans being hired as bush pilots in Namibia and Botswana but at some point Botswana and maybe Namibia had a new policy; any non-citizens would have to have 500 hours total time to protect the local development of pilots. It's the same as in Europe if the person is a non-eu citizen, where they'll state you have to have the right to live, that is residency or citizenship.
      Pre-2020 I'd say there was a chance in being hired but as you know the border restrictions has reduced demand and thus the size of their operations, but who says you shouldn't try. It is true most operators will only consider your application if you visit their office versus calls or emails.
      Information on contract length, rosters, and salaries can be found on pprune.org or avcom.co.za
      Note though due to the length of getting a work permit and the investment required in training you being there less than 24 months may not be ideal for them.
